Victim Services Unit

The Elizabeth Police Department (EPD) is dedicated to providing the highest quality of services available to victims of crime and tragedy.  We provide immediate crisis intervention and support for victims and survivors of crimes in cases including but not limited to death, domestic violence, sexual assault and other crimes. 

We ensure that victims are aware of their rights under the Colorado Law and offer information about the Victims Rights Act and the Crime Victim Compensation Act.  We help all victims and survivors with emotional support, long-term support services available within our community and step-by-step assistance through the criminal justice system.

The Victim Services Unit is available 24 hours a day, 7 days a week.
